Transaction 59a9f7cc7d170b65c553bb973321a8055920dafa50643354f82b319992ec0eaa
1 Input
1 Output
-
59a9f7cc7d170b65c553bb973321a8055920dafa50643354f82b319992ec0eaa:0
- value
- 397310
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5de6e244b5b18cd384d93696cacc30581a4d9be
- address
- bc1quh0xufzttvvv6wzdjd5ketxrqkq6fkd7y6e8ur